In order to do export anything to your accounting system, you first need to set up an export method in Divly. Divly supports a variety of export methods to ensure that you can easily synchronize your crypto transactions with your accounting software.


Connecting a new export method

Follow the below steps to set up a new export method in Divly:

  1. In the sidebar, click on Exports.

  2. Under Integrations, choose either your bookkeeping software or the file type you would like to use.

  3. Follow the steps the prompts to authorize the connection if needed.

Note: If you choose a File Export method, then you only need to click the integration once for it to be activated on your Divly account.

If you choose to connect directly to your Accounting Software, you will need to login and provide authorization to Divly before your are ready for the next step.


I can't find my accounting software on Divly

If you can't see your accounting software listed amongst the possible options, you can take the following actions:

  1. Contact [email protected] and we can start a process to have it supported.

  2. Use a file export method that is supported by your bookeeping program. Every software should accept one or more file types.
